Output d588da8189d9f92665617b5ee1a090114283d430752f28c933da9eb6b0bc5db0:1

value
1308785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a6438090b3996d2b0a83e81afa780a67bc90f5 OP_EQUAL
address
37VZfqDVJKSFW56KXzJ5ziik7q9zr6grJs
transaction
d588da8189d9f92665617b5ee1a090114283d430752f28c933da9eb6b0bc5db0
confirmations
190057
spent
true